Life’s challenges can shape us in powerful ways. I know because I’ve faced my own share of struggles—and now I use that strength to walk alongside my clients, one day at a time. I believe that our weaknesses can become our greatest strengths, especially with patience and resilience. Before becoming a therapist, I was a Registered Nurse, learning the power of compassion and truly listening to people’s stories. With a Master’s Degree in Marriage and Family Therapy, I bring experience and heart into every session. I’m here to help you find strength, hope, and change.
I help clients grow through Individual, Family, Pre-Marital, and Grief therapy, using Structural, Narrative, Solution-Focused, Transgenerational, and Strategic approaches. Growing up in a family that faced adversity taught me empathy, compassion, and shaped my approach to helping clients. I offer virtual therapy for your comfort and convenience.
I’m passionate about Couples therapy, drawing from over 30 years of marriage experience and 10 years as a counselor. I help couples improve communication and interaction patterns using Emotionally-Focused therapy and other methods to strengthen connections.
